Do2dtun Exposes Radio Station’s 8-Month Unpaid Salaries Saga

Renowned On-Air Personality, Do2dtun, has taken to social media to condemn a radio station’s alleged non-payment of staff salaries for eight months. He expressed his outrage, labeling the situation as “cruel and inhumane.”

Do2dtun specifically highlighted the plight of his friends and colleagues at Soundcity, questioning how they manage to cope without receiving their salaries for an extended period. His claims were substantiated by a former employee’s tweet, which detailed a toxic work environment where staff were frequently terminated and replaced to avoid salary payments.

The exposé has ignited a conversation within the industry about the importance of fair labor practices and the need for radio stations to prioritize their employees’ welfare. Do2dtun’s call-out serves as a reminder of the consequences of neglecting staff compensation and the importance of promoting a positive work environment.
